Occasionally you may need to temporarily pause email delivery, due to a server decommissioning or a service migration, for example.
This can be easily done in the Control Panel within Security Settings>Spam and Malware Protection, by pecifying a non-existent server into the destination server field.
We recomend using 169.254.0.1, as it's a reserved public IP, which won't be reachable. We advise against using reserved private IP's like 192.168.0.1, 127.0.0.1, or others like 1.1.1.1.
Then we would spool your inbound traffic up to 7 rolling days, and the outbound traffic up to 24h, while you make the necessary updates on your end.
Once the final recipient server is up and running again, you could enter the correct (or even a new) destination server and we would begin delivering all traffic held in the queue to this host.
